What are the responsibilities and job description for the Senior Web Developer (WordPress Specialist) position at Punchcut?

Salary: see job descriptionPunchcut is looking for a senior developer with strong front-end skills and solid WordPress expertise to join us on a contract basis. You should be comfortable translating detailed designs into clean, modular components and shaping the underlying WordPress architecture to support them. You understand how to build accessible, customizable, and reliable experiences, and youre confident working independently while partnering closely with designers. You thrive in a fast-paced, problem-solving environment where clarity, quality, and maintainability matter.RESPONSIBILITIESDevelop custom WordPress components and blocks based on provided designsSet up or adapt data architecture to support scalability, modularity, and long-term maintainabilityImplement clean, semantic, accessible front-end code aligned to WCAG standardsBuild intuitive, configurable admin experiences for designers and content authorsEnsure internationalization support across components and user-facing flowsOptimize for performance, responsiveness, and cross-browser reliabilityCollaborate daily with designers and creative team members to translate experiences into working codeProvide thoughtful documentation, technical guidance, and recommendations throughout the projectQUALIFICATIONSStrong interpersonal, communication, and problem-solving skillsAbility to quickly develop high-fidelity custom components and blocks to realize design intentAbility to create scalable systems that support reuse, customization, and quality controlAbility to collaborate closely with a design teamProficiency in modern HTML, CSS, and JavaScriptExperience creating multilingual/i18n-ready WordPress systemsExperience integrating external APIs or creating REST endpoints within WordPressAbility to craft smooth, considered micro-interactions using CSS transitions and keyframe animationsBONUSExperience building interactive forms, data visualizations, or dynamic UI statesFamiliarity with accessibility testing tools and WCAG-aligned development practicesExperience architecting or optimizing WordPress for performance (caching, queries, asset strategy)Experience designing or contributing to component libraries or design systemsExperience with structured content modeling and custom admin UI developmentAbility to help Punchcut, its people, and its clients understand how to build modern, flexible WordPress experiences that scaleRATEFor W-2 Temporary Employees:Hourly Rate: $59 $74 per hour (based on skills and experience)Benefits: Eligible for sick leave and 401kFor 1099 Independent Contractors:Hourly Rate: $80 $100 per hour (based on skills and experience)Benefits: Not eligible for company-sponsored benefits; responsible for own taxes and insuranceAll candidates will be hired as W2 temporary employees unless they can prove eligibility as a 1099 independent contractor.WHY PUNCHCUT?Punchcut is a human interface design and innovation company. For over twenty years we've worked with the world's top companies to envision, design and launch connected products and services that engage customers and transform businesses. We believe strongly in approaching these design challenges from many different perspectives so we might find the most important, innovative, and universal solutions.Our team is building a company that is diverse and inclusive one where everyone feels valued and free to be their authentic selves. At Punchcut we embrace differences and all of the amazing, unique characteristics that make us human.Punchcut designers are located across many time zones. We offer a virtual first, flexible work schedule and take pride in providing a balanced work environment. Full time employees receive medical, dental, life, and disability insurance as well as paid and sabbatical time off. Additional benefits for full time employees include a 401k plan as well as allowances for technology, home office set up, professional development and wellness.Cultivating a diverse, thriving, dispersed work environment is never done. Were growing our network of people and programs to help us realize this vision. Join us in designing for the future we all want to see.Punchcut is an Equal Opportunity Employer
